over the weekend, the Washington Post ran an article about a piece of legislation I helped negotiate last Congress. It was entitled the ``Ensuring Patient Access and Effective Drug Enforcement Act'' and was intended to encourage greater collaboration between DEA and the regulated community in the fight against opioid abuse. The Post article was sharply critical of this legislation, suggesting that it effectively gutted DEA's ability to do its job. It also suggested the pharmaceutical industry put one over on Congress. I rise to set the record straight on these allegations and to provide a fuller account of how this legislation passed the Senate and became law. First, some background. The Controlled Substances Act requires drug distributors to obtain a ``registration'' from DEA in order to distribute controlled substances, including prescription drugs. The act further authorizes DEA to suspend a distributor's registration in certain circumstances, such as where a distributor has been convicted of a crime involving controlled substances or had a State license suspended. Before suspending a registration, DEA must issue a show cause order directing the distributor to explain why its registration should not be suspended.
